Police searching for two missing tourists in the Kilkivan area have located a vehicle believed to have been used by the couple.

The 26-year-old man and 23-year-old woman, who were Chinese tourists, were travelling in a silver Subaru Forester from Brisbane to the North Burnett when they failed to reach their destination.

A search began on Wednesday morning involving police, SES and helicopters in the Kilkivan to Mundubbera area.

A silver vehicle was located on Wednesday afternoon in floodwaters near Kilkivan-Tansey Road and McArthur Road.

This is west of Kilkivan, near the Wide Bay Creek bridge.

Photos taken from the 7News helicopter show the vehicle semi-submerged.

Police are at the scene and the search is continuing.

Anyone with information regarding the whereabouts of the two missing tourists have been urged to contact police.
